Output 1840d72560a3f53a43d11a0bc88bf5c5cde95e582db90982ddc392c620c55a2a:0

value
862675012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 738189297c87429a244c46a82ebf63c6d5de4723 OP_EQUAL
address
3CDkouf3WxRxVk46Tubj68HTBWdcxobfag
transaction
1840d72560a3f53a43d11a0bc88bf5c5cde95e582db90982ddc392c620c55a2a
spent
true